Bosch 24" Dishwasher (Model: SHE43R52UC)

Read Product QuestionsProduct Features
- 48 dBA - quietest in its class
- Sanitize option eliminates bacteria and enhances drying results
- AquaStop® leak protection detects leaks in the solid molded base of the dishwasher, shuts down operation and automatically pumps out water so it cannot make contact with the floor
- InfoLight® beams on the floor to indicate dishwasher is running
- Stainless steel TallTub
- Silver painted fascia design in stainless steel
- Saves up to 280 gallons of water each year
- Energy Star® qualified model - Exceeds Energy Star® requirements for water by 69 percent
- EcoSense™ wash management system checks water condition and decides if a second fresh water fill is necessary. Reduces energy usage by up to 20 percent
- Half load cycle for small loads
- 14 place setting capacity
- Manual height adjustment upper rack
- Long silverware basket

Auto selects the right wash and dry settings by using two separate sensors to measure temperature, soil level and load size during prewash and during the wash cycle. Cleans tough soils better while using the right amount of time, energy and water.
The power of steam helps to loosen caked on food before normal wash cycles, eliminating the need to manually rinse dishes.
Eco-friendly cycle uses less energy without compromising cleaning performance.
Gentle-pressure wash cycle ideal for protecting fragile china, crystal, and glassware.
Wash cycle that employs maximum water pressure, or runs longer, hotter washes to clean heavily soiled items such as dishes with burned-on foods.
Abbreviated wash cycle that saves time and energy. Ideal for lightly soiled loads. Cycle time is approximately 20 minutes.
High-power wash cycle ideal for hard-to-clean or heavily soiled dishes, pots, and pans.
This feature is an extra program to run before a full dishwasher cycle to help to remove burnt on stains and grease.
This feature enables you to set the dishwasher to turn on at a later time. For example, you can set the timer to turn on while you are asleep and when energy use rates are lower.
Make sure your dishes are reliably clean with the NSF Certified Sani Rinse option. Using a high temperature rinse, this option eliminates 99.999% of food soil bacteria, as certified by NSF International.
The industry-exclusive Eco Dry option is the most efficient drying option on our dishwashers. Perfect for those who want to save energy, its shorter heating time uses 70% less energy compared to using Heated Dry.
Choose this option when additional cleaning of items like baby bottles glassware or dishes is required.
An international standard for energy efficient consumer products originated in the USA.
The quantity of wash levels that a dishwasher offers. The level determines how the water is sprayed during the wash cycle.
Levels of quiet operation with this system of sound-reducing insulation.
Allows the "brains" of the dishwasher to determine water temperature and increase it as necessary.
The rinse aid indicator will show when rinse aid is needed to be added to the dishwasher. Rinse aid prevents "spotting" on glassware and can also improve drying performance as there is less water remaining to be dried.
Save time and a kitchen towel by using the heated dry feature on your dishwasher. The heated dry setting is used to dry dishes at the end of the clean cycle.
With this specialized option, you don't have to wait for a full load to wash a few items. The Top Rack Wash option saves you time and energy by washing dishes in the top rack. Now breakfast bowls and coffee cups don't need to sit in the sink.
Designed with a locking system that stops accidental changes to the cycles or options when the dishwasher is in use and prevents unauthorized users such as young children from using it.
The height of the dishwasher when the adjustable feet on the underside of the dishwasher are extended.
The height of the dishwasher when the adjustable feet on the underside of the dishwasher are not extended.
The depth of the dishwasher including the door of the dishwasher.
The depth of the dishwasher including the door of the dishwasher in the open position.
Built-in models require dedicated plumbing to bring water in and drain water out and also take up cabinet space. Portables have wheels, allowing movement around the kitchen and use the kitchen faucet and sink to wash dishes and drain the dishwater.
Type of material (e.g. plastic or stainless steel) that is used for the tub.
Design (e. g. tall or standard) of tub.
The three types of dishwasher controls are mechanical (i.e. turn dial), push-button and dial (i.e. combine a dial with push buttons for individual cycles) and electronic (i.e. solid state touchpad with no moving parts).
The amount or number of washing cycles that are available to select on the dishwasher.
The maximum number of place settings that can be contained on your dishwasher's racks.
Allows for 100% usable upper rack space, the EZ-2-Lift adjustable upper rack has a narrow profile that does not interfere with loading. Easily adjust the upper rack 2" up or down to fit larger items in either rack for improved capacity flexibility.
By folding the tines in one direction it is easier to place dishes inside. By folding them in the other direction it is easier to put large items like bowls inside.
Allows you to stack two levels of coffee mugs or secure delicate glassware during the wash cycle when used as a stemware holder.

Comments about Bosch 24" Dishwasher:
It is so quiet that I had to check it was actually working! We have an open kitchen/family room and I don't have to worry about running the dishwasher when we're watching TV - with our old dishwasher we had to crank up the volume. Fits a ton of dishes and I really liked the examples provided about how to load for maximum capacity. Dishes come out clean and spotless. We love it.
